Maryhill Station greets travellers with a streamlined set of amenities focused on efficient transit. Although there's no ticket office or machines for collecting prepaid tickets, options for purchasing tickets online remain accessible. Passengers will find smartcard validators for ease of access instead. Help points dot the premises, providing real-time support and assistance should you need it.
Accessibility is a priority, evident through step-free access facilities available at the station. There are ramps to both platforms, and a designated Passenger Assist meeting point located at the Help Point on Platform 1. It's worth noting that the stepping distance between the train and platform might be greater towards the rear of platform 1, so a bit of care is recommended when boarding or alighting.
While Maryhill does not boast lounges or food and drink outlets, seating areas ensure a comfortable wait. There’s plenty of opportunity to relax as you anticipate your train’s arrival.

Walmer station boasts a range of facilities to ensure that your travel experience is as smooth as possible. With a bustling ticket office open every weekday and Saturday from 06:30 to 11:00, obtaining your desired rail tickets is straightforward. Ticket machines are available for your convenience, including accessible machines positioned on platform 1 for ease of access. While Walmer issues smartcards, it’s worth noting that smartcard validators are not present at the station.
For those in need of assistance, the station offers robust support with accessible help points and ramp access to trains. Although step-free access is provided to platform 1 and the side entrance from Sydney Road, a subway with steps connects the platforms, requiring extra caution for those with reduced mobility.
